Jeeno Thitikul’s Triumph at the LET PIF Saudi Ladies International Tournament
Jeeno Thitikul, a 21-year-old golf prodigy hailing from Ratchaburi, Thailand, has kicked off her 2025 golf season with an impressive victory at the Ladies European Tour PIF Saudi Ladies International tournament. The rising star, currently ranked fourth in the world, showcased her exceptional skills by finishing the 54-hole event in Riyadh at an impressive 16 under par, securing a well-deserved prize of $675,000.

The Thrilling Victory in Riyadh
In a thrilling final round at the Riyadh Golf Club, Jeeno demonstrated her prowess on the course, finishing four strokes ahead of South Korea’s Somi Lee. With a final round score of three-under 69, Jeeno’s performance was nothing short of spectacular. Her remarkable journey to victory included an opening round of 67 and a stunning eight-under-par 64 on Friday, which stood as the lowest round of the entire week.

Reflecting on her triumph, Jeeno expressed her elation, describing the win as an early birthday gift, with her 22nd birthday just around the corner on February 20. Jeeno’s Journey to Success
Having previously triumphed at the season-ending CME Group Tour Championship in 2024, where she claimed a record prize of $4 million, Jeeno’s total earnings for the year on the LPGA Tour amounted to an impressive $6.06 million. The Prestigious PIF Saudi Ladies International Tournament
The PIF Saudi Ladies International tournament, held at the Riyadh Golf Club, stands out as one of the most lucrative events in women’s golf, with a total prize purse of $5 million. Sponsored by the Public Investment Fund (PIF), the Saudi government’s sovereign wealth fund, the tournament attracts top talent from around the globe, offering a platform for players to showcase their skills on an international stage.
